A Transatlantic Talent

Born in England on January 8, 1999, Brandon Austin possesses a unique international profile. While his formative years and professional career have been rooted in English football, he has also represented the United States at the youth international level. This dual eligibility and representation highlight the global nature of modern professional sports and the opportunities available to athletes with diverse backgrounds.

Players often choose to represent a nation based on various factors, including family heritage, playing opportunities, and personal connection. Austin's involvement with the U.S. youth teams suggests a significant connection to American soccer, potentially offering him a different pathway for international competition and development compared to solely focusing on English national teams.

The Strategic Significance of Goalkeeping in Elite Football

The goalkeeper is a pivotal figure in the tactical framework of any football team, and Brandon Austin's role exemplifies this. Beyond the fundamental requirement of preventing goals, goalkeepers are increasingly integrated into a team's offensive strategy. Their ability to launch counter-attacks with precise long throws or kicks, or to maintain possession by playing short passes to defenders, can dictate the tempo and flow of a match.

Furthermore, a goalkeeper's command of their penalty area, including organizing the defensive line and dealing with aerial threats, is crucial for maintaining defensive solidity. In the high-stakes environment of the Premier League, a goalkeeper's performance can often be the deciding factor between victory and defeat, making their psychological resilience and decision-making capabilities as important as their physical prowess.
